WebMar 1, 2006 · Before testing any master cylinder, always remove the master cylinder reservoir cap and inspect the fluid level and color, and the viscosity of the brake fluid. A low fluid level may indicate worn brake pads or a leak in the brake hydraulic system. Discolored fluid indicates excessive contamination of the fluid from moisture or foreign materials.
